We do find however that Hello????? as a topic does not let us narrow down your request to a specific area of Note 8 functionality.

If you could be more specific in your subject title and description then you will find many people prepared to help.

Relevant information will include sensible title, descriptive content, specific app or OS functionality information, android version. If there are specific errors or notifications given then exact text should be included so we can google it for you if we have not previously come across it ourselves.
Additional useful information may include country, carrier, description of sounds if relevant, if this has changed with a recent update to this phone or behaved differently on an older phone, screenshot if possible.
